Is there mountains in San Diego?

The Laguna Mountains are a mountain range of the Peninsular Ranges System in eastern San Diego County, southern California. The mountains run in a northwest/southeast alignment for approximately 35 miles (56 km).

Where is the purple trail in San Diego?

The 2.6 mile “Jerry Schad Memorial Trail” follows sidewalks and some road surfaces. It is a tree-lined, gently sloping route through the entire West Mesa, featuring some of the park’s finest botanical treasures. Difficulty level: Medium. Follow the #43 square purple trail markers.

Can you fall off Potato Chip Rock?

To get to the Potato Chip, you have to jump from one boulder to another. The only scary part was when other people were jumping onto it, and you can feel the vibrations of the rock. Seemed secure enough, but if it happened to break off, at most you would only fall one and a half stories.

How long of a hike is Potato Chip Rock?

Woodson Trail. Experience this 7.3-mile out-and-back trail near Poway, California. Generally considered a moderately challenging route, it takes an average of 4 h 19 min to complete.

Can kids hike potato chip?

The trail is totally kid friendly. There are no open edges where your kids are going to run off of and the trail is paved the whole way until you get to the rock (about 100m of unpaved trail).
